Accomplish … WebThe biggest discussion you’ll hear about the accents is distinguishing the Southern Drawl from the Southern Twang. The key difference is that the drawl is spoken much slower and doesn’t pronounce “r’s” as much. Whereas the twang is spoken faster, is more nasal, and pronounces “r’s” more sharply. WebThese dialects have traditionally been called “ Frankish ”; the dialects of the northeastern part of the Netherlands (Overijssel, Drenthe, Groningen) have been called “ Saxon” and show certain affinities with Low German dialects to the east. WebArea and dialects In Germany, Lowlands Saxon is officially recognized in eight northern states (Bundesländer): Schleswig-Holstein, Hamburg, Lower Saxony, ... even to Rhenish and Alemannic varieties much farther south. Furthermore, Lowlands Saxon and German are descendants of two separate languages: Old Saxon and Old (“High”) ...
